Output 7d557586c177f6a1bce09054cdf81f39be6221f297e5c4795828a6a4b3052720:1

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ac2975e58a4a91430d29c5f7a7ec573c4987080e OP_EQUAL
address
3HPKpGSMTwJ89nVTb5SCFvMadu19otWZii
transaction
7d557586c177f6a1bce09054cdf81f39be6221f297e5c4795828a6a4b3052720
spent
true